    English: :Microplastics in the surface ocean Microplastics are buoyant plastic materials smaller than 0.5 centimeters in diameter. Future global accumulation in the surface ocean is shown under three plastic emissions scenarios: (1) emissions to the oceans stop in 2020; (2) they stagnate at 2020 emission rates; or (3) continue to grow until 2050 in line with historical plastic production rates.

    Innovation is production or adoption, assimilation, and exploitation of a value-added novelty in economic and social spheres; renewal and enlargement of products, services, and markets; development of new methods of production; and the establishment of new management systems. It is both a process and an outcome.
